Vishal Gulati

Ph.D. in Management

Biography

Vishal is a Ph.D. Candidate in Management (Finance) at the College of Management, Mahidol University, and was awarded the prestigious Mahidol University Scholarship for Ph.D. Students. His research focuses on understanding why academics and practitioners have been unable to accurately forecast exchange rate movements despite exchange rate economics being a well-established and extensively studied field. Additionally, his work seeks to identify and propose forecasting solutions that could address and mitigate these challenges.

Vishal has a decade of professional experience in global economic research, Thai economic research, public policy analysis, and academic research. He received his Bachelor of Economics from Thammasat University. He was awarded the Royal Thai Government Scholarship to pursue his MSc. In Economics at the University of Warwick, United Kingdom.
